The real value of Monarch Pink Sheet, also known as its intrinsic value, is the underlying worth of Monarch Cement Company, which is reflected in its stock price. It is based on Monarch Cement's financial performance, assets, liabilities, growth prospects, management team, or industry conditions. The intrinsic value of Monarch Cement's stock can be calculated using various methods such as discounted cash flow analysis, price-to-earnings ratio, or price-to-book ratio. That value may differ from its current market price, which is determined by supply and demand factors such as investor sentiment, market trends, news, and other external factors that may influence Monarch Cement's stock price. It is important to note that the real value of any stock may change over time based on changes in the company's performance.

The Monarch Cement Company Current Valuation Analysis

Monarch Cement's Enterprise Value is a firm valuation proxy that approximates the current market value of a company. It is typically used to determine the takeover or merger price of a firm. Unlike Market Cap, this measure takes into account the entire liquid asset, outstanding debt, and exotic equity instruments that the company has on its balance sheet. When a takeover occurs, the parent company will have to assume the target company's liabilities but will take possession of all cash and cash equivalents.

Enterprise Value

 = 

Market Cap + Debt

-

Cash
